Dive into the untold tales of Georgetown with a fresh lens! Starting February 2024, join us every third Saturday at 2pm to uncover a side of this posh DC neighborhood not often highlighted. From its roots as a bustling tobacco port to its complex history with the slave trade and the vibrant African American community that called it home, Georgetown's past is rich and multifaceted. Walk the streets where generations of black citizens have left their indelible mark, starting from 3206 O Street NW and concluding with the historic significance of Mt. Zion Cemetery.
